Australian Geographical Inquiries: Final Report of the Evaluation of the Second Pilot Implementation of Senior Geography Unit III B. Syllabus Evaluation Report.
Lidstone, John G.
The Queensland (Australia) Board of Secondary School Studies developed a geography syllabus for senior classrooms which was implemented in 1980. Revisions of the syllabus took place in 1982 and 1986. Based on the 1986 evaluation, this report provides an evaluation, a summary of the findings, and advice to principals and teachers. Twelve case studies, based on the data gathered from the schools surveyed, accompany the report. The case studies reflect the teachers' views and the students' perceptions of the syllabus. Copies of the correspondence and the evaluation instruments, the statistical data from the student questionnaires, and the explanations for the case study graphs are included in the appendices. (DJC)
